  2. David "Fathead" Newman (February 24, 1933 – January 20, 2009) was an American jazz and rhythm-and-blues saxophonist, who made numerous recordings as a session musician and leader, but is best known for his work as a sideman on seminal 1950s and early 1960s recordings by Ray Charles.

  6. David Newman, detto Fathead (Corsicana, 24 febbraio 1933 – Kingston, 20 gennaio 2009), è stato un sassofonista statunitense. Nel corso della sua carriera ha lavorato con Ray Charles negli anni '50 e '60; Hank Crawford, B.B. King, Junior Mance, Eddie Harris, Charles Kynard, Herbie Mann, Jimmy McGriff, Shirley Scott e altri artisti.
